Poor, Amelia E. b. 1815 - d. 2 May 1874 59 yrs. R 98 S 201
Poor. On Saturday, the 2d inst., Amelia, beloved wife of Capt. Wm. Poore, second daughter of Rev. James S. Mothershead, of Westmoreland county, Va., in the 59th year of her age, leaving a large circle of warm and devoted friends to mourn her loss. Not lost but gone before.

  Poor, George H. d. 29 May 1852 46 yrs. R 37 S 69
Poor. In this city on Saturday morning the 29th instant after a lingering illness which he bore with Christian fortitude and resignation, George H. Poor, aged 46 years, son of the late Moses Poor. Funeral from his mother's residence on F street this (Monday) morning at 10 o'clock. The friends of the family are invited to attend.

  Poor, Moses d. 14 Oct 1851 78 yrs. R 37 S 69
Poor. At his residence in this city on Tuesday night last, after a brief illness, Moses Poor, Esq. in the 79th year of his age. Mr. Poor was for many years a resident of Washington and was much esteemed for his upright, exemplary and amiable character. He has left a large and respected family circle and numerous friends to lament his death. His funeral will take place this afternoon at 3 o'clock from his late residence on F street.

  Poor, William A. b. 1810 - d. 1 May 1875 65 yrs. R 98 S 202
Poor. On the morning of the 1st instant, Capt. William A. Poor, after a long and painful illness of softening of the brain, in the 66th year of his age; born in Westmoreland county, Va., but for many years a resident of this city.
